Why Most Blogs Fail to Drive Traffic (And How to Fix It)?
Google processes 8.5 billion searches daily, but despite the massive search volume, many blogs fail to rank due to a few common SEO pitfalls:
Keyword Gaps: Many blogs target overly competitive keywords or overlook valuable long-tail keywords with low competition and high traffic.
Poor Readability: Blogs that feature long, unbroken text can be difficult to read, resulting in a negative user experience. Both readers and Google prefer content that’s easy to digest.
Inconsistency: : Posting irregularly can make it hard to build a loyal audience.

Doing Keyword Research
Since you just launched your website. focus on high-traffic, low-competition keywords, typically long-tail keywords. These are more specific and easier to rank for.
How to Find These Keywords:
Use a keyword research tool like Ahrefs, SEMrush, or Moz. I personally use ryrob.
Search for long tail keywords keywords that have high traffic and low complexity
Save those keywords in the google doc or notes
Optimizing for Those Keywords
Keyword research alone isn’t enough to rank on Google’s first page. Your website needs good domain authority (DA) to compete.
How to Build Domain Authority:
List your website on high-DA platforms like Product Hunt, AngelList, Crunchbase, and similar directories.

Writing Blogs for Those Keywords
Once your website’s authority improves, start creating content around the saved keywords:
Ensure the content is engaging, clear, and provides value.
Use the keywords naturally in headings, subheadings, and throughout the blog.
Optimize meta descriptions, titles, and images for SEO.
